At first glance, body positivity and physical wellness might seem like opposing forces. Critics often worry that radical self-acceptance leads to complacency regarding health. However, research suggests the opposite: individuals with high "body appreciation" are more likely to engage in health-promoting behaviors, such as regular physical activity, intuitive eating, and better sleep hygiene.
